Lammy: 'No timetable' for PM's resignation
Description
Deputy Prime Minister David Lammy says there's "no timetable" for the Prime Minister's resignation, insisting the government remains focused despite growing pressure on Sir Keir Starmer and ongoing questions over his leadership.
